Transaction 41fc986f63effe21c8efa2c79884d6f398f2eb8cd7bf0aa6310b22399346511d
1 Input
1 Output
-
41fc986f63effe21c8efa2c79884d6f398f2eb8cd7bf0aa6310b22399346511d:0
- value
- 99986054
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3e525aea1e792c5f15e30665a74b65e2c1da25d
- address
- bc1q60jjtt4pu7fvtu27xpn95a9ktckpmgjaf4uf8r